- Notes
- Fictitious correspondence by the author, interspersed with Karoline Günderode’s poems and dialogues. Margaret Fuller and Minna Wesselhoeft are the unnamed translators. See pp. 231-32 for the handsome, elderly "old-clothes Jew" in Marburg named Ephraim.
